Epoxy.com Product #830
MOISTURE VAPOR TREATMENT
DESCRIPTION
Epoxy.com Product #830 is a two component modified epoxy system designed
to seal concrete and reduce moisture vapor transmission prior to applying
finished flooring. Epoxy.com Product #830 has proven to reduce moisture vapor emissions and
be resistant to damage from high alkalinity. Epoxy.com Product #830 is an environmentally friendly material containing
no hydrocarbons or other solvents making it zero (0) VOC.
ADVANTAGES
- Reduces moisture vapor transmission rate through concrete.
- Provides excellent resistance to highly alkaline conditions.
- Gives excellent bond to properly prepared concrete.
- Has convenient 2:1 mixing ratio.
- High physical properties.
- Can be rapidly surfaced with a variety of finished flooring
materials.
CONSIDERATIONS
- Substrate temperature must be a minimum of 55oF before, during and 72
hours after installation.
- Must have effective vapor barrier directly under substrate.
- For use only on properly prepared surfaces; must be free of dirt, waxes,
curing agents and other foreign materials.
- Does not function as a crack reflective membrane.
TYPICAL USES
- Epoxy.com Product #830 is designed as a negative side moisture vapor
retarder to reduce moisture vapor transmission through concrete.
- Epoxy.com Product #830 can also be an effective primer for fast
recoat under Epoxy.com flooring systems.
COLOR
Translucent Red
COMPOSITION
Epoxy.com Product #830 is a highly cross-linked, alkaline resistant epoxy
composition.
TYPICAL PROPERTIES & PERFORMANCE DATA
|
| Tensile Strength -ASTM-D-638 |
10,400 psi |
| Tensile Elongation -ASTM-D-638 |
2 - 4%
|
| Modulus of Elasticity -ASTM-D-638 |
2500 psi |
| Bond Strength to Concrete -ASTM-D-4541 |
400-500 psi
100% Concrete Failure |
| Permeability - ASTM E-96 |
1Coat (10-12 mils) - 0.09 Perms
2 Coats (20 mils total) - 0.04 Perms |
| Water Vapor Transmission -Grams/hr/sq.
meter ASTM-E-96 |
1 coat - 0.023
2 coats - 0.012 |
| Alkaline Resistance ASTM-D-1308 |
|
| 7 day Immersion |
10% Sodium Hydroxide - unaffected
50% Sodium Hydroxide - unaffected |
| 14 day Immersion |
10% Sodium Hydroxide - unaffected
50% Sodium Hydroxide - unaffected |
| Hardness Shore D -
ASTM-D-2240 |
85 |
| VOC |
Zero |
| Water Absorption -
ASTM-D-570 |
nil |
| Mix Ratio |
2:1 by Volume |
| Pot Life |
25-35 Minutes |
| Recoat Time |
Minimum 4-6 Hrs
Maximum 72 Hrs. |
APPLICATION
SURFACE PREPARATION
Surface preparation is the most critical portion of any successful
resinous flooring system. All substrates must be properly prepared as
outlined in Epoxy.com Surface Preparation Guide. Work must be
performed by trained or experienced contractors or maintenance personnel.
Epoxy.com Product #830 is a moisture vapor suppressant for concrete
substrates. Surface and air temperature must be a minimum of 55oF during
installation and cure.
Concrete surface must be free of dirt, waxes, curing agents, any other
foreign materials, and must be structurally sound. Surfaces should be vacuum
shot blasted to “open” surface porosity or by diamond grinding with coarse
stones. Surface profile must be a minimum CSP-4-CSP-5 profile according to
International Concrete Repair Institute Guideline #03732.
Concrete surfaces should be tested for moisture transmission according to
ASTM-F-2170 (Relative Humidity in Concrete Floor Slabs using in situ probes)
and ASTM-F-1869 (Measuring Moisture Vapor Emission Rate of Concrete Subfloor
using Anhydrous Calcium Chloride).
Epoxy.com Product #830 may be applied in a single coat of 12 mils (130
sq.ft. per gallon) when relative humidity readings are below 95% or MVT
readings are below 12# per 1000 sq.ft./24 hrs. Higher readings require
consultation with Epoxy.com Technical Services and may require a second coat
of Epoxy.com Product #830 of 10 mils (160 sq.ft. per gallon).
Fill all cracks and non-moving joints with Epoxy.com Product #830. If
material continues to disappear into the void, add fumed silica to get a gel
consistency and “putty” into the void to completely seal. Detailing with
Epoxy.com Product #32 membrane and glass mesh is done after the Epoxy.com Product #830
application.
MIXING & SPREADING
Stir resin and hardener separately prior to mixing. Mix ratio is 2 parts
resin Part A to one part hardener Part B. Pour together and mix thoroughly
for 60-90 seconds. Apply at the rate of 120-130 sq.ft./gal. Apply extra
material to areas showing penetration and soaking into the concrete. All
areas should show a uniform gloss and a uniform 12 mils minimum thickness.
Maximum recoat time for Epoxy.com Product #830 is 72 hours. It may be
advantageous to prime with Epoxy.com Product #899 primer or a second coat of Epoxy.com
Product #830 at 200-250/sq.ft. and lightly broadcast 30 mesh silica to help
achieve a good mechanical bond.
For areas showing moisture vapor greater than 12#/1000sq.ft/24 hours or
humidity readings greater than 95% consult with Epoxy.com Technical
Department.
